The third edition of the Science in Today’s World Series is written in compliance with the Philippine K to 12 curriculum gradually implemented from 2012 to 2016. The contents of the textbook often link ideas to real-life situations. The textbook is supported by laboratory manual that contains two types of meaningful activities: experiments and open- ended activities. Another supplementary material is the teachers wraparound edition (TWE), which was written to help the teachers in planning learning activities with the end in mind—to teach for understanding.
Pre-Learning Check – serves as a diagnostic test to assess students’ prior knowledge
Quick Quiz – a minds-on activity that elicits immediate feedback on students’ learning
Quick Lab – a hands-on activity that engages students in an active science learning process
Career in Science – suggests professions to encourage students to take a career path in science
Scientist of the Time – highlights scientists who contributed significantly to the development of science
Glimpse of History – emphasizes historical achievements and developments in science
Misconception Alert – identifies and corrects common student misconceptions in science
Technology in Focus – updates students on the latest developments in science and technology
Challenge through ICT – an ICT-integrated assessment connected to the technology presented in Technology in Focus
Concept Mastery, Apply What You Know, and Check Your Understanding – assessments that test students’ knowledge and understanding on the concepts presented in the discussion
Science in Action – assessments that require students to create a product or perform a task
